Over the years, HKSEC has matured drastically in both
magnitude and quality. It attracts highly ambitious,
passionate participants and welcomes anyone who
harbors an entrepreneurial spirit, with a drive to make
social changes with a simple idea. "Students don't end
their journey here," Professor Au said. "HKSEC picks
students up at an idea stage, coach them and brings
them to a point where they have their plan sorted out and
have testing customers. But then they need to expand by
themselves. For this, they need more money and more
assistance. HKSEC shows them the ways to scale up and
use resources wisely in order to get bigger and make a
larger impact."
Inspiration Beyond an Entrepreneurial Career
Students who do not plan to pursue an entrepreneurial
career can also benefit from this programme since it gives
them more insights on how an entrepreneur thinks, what
an enterprise is and how an enterprise functions. This
knowledge will eventually help them to advance in their
future career.
HKSEC allows students to grasp that big organizations are
not the only career option that prevails in today's world.
They have alternatives. “Students may originally think there
are only the government and profit-making corporations
(businesses) in the world. But now they realize that there
are also other types of organizations - social organizations
can provide an alternative career prospect."

廚餘
創未來 –
實踐社企創業夢
學生記者:吳欣鍵
少大學生畢業後會選擇投身商界,但中大工商
管理學士(綜合)畢業生鄭營啟(Jack)選擇了
一條與別不同的道路。他投身了社會企業(即企業以
所得利潤主要用作再投資於本身業務,以達到既定的
社會目的的行業),更創辦了回收廚餘和相關環保教
育的社會企業。以下Jack會與同學們分享創業路上的
一點一滴。
初見商機 確立目標
在2008年,仍在中大就讀的Jack與一位環境科學系
的朋友傾談,覺得廚餘是一個嚴峻迫切的問題,於是
萌生了以社企模式解決廚餘問題的創業念頭。為了豐
富自己在該方面的知識,他積極搜集相關資料。Jack
為尋找機會進一步實踐理想,參加了由香港中文大學
創業研究中心舉辦的香港社會企業挑戰賽。勝出比
賽後的獎金便成為了Jack創業的第一筆資金。此後
Jack亦參加了香港社企投資論壇及中國大學生創業計
劃競賽,憑著出色的表現獲獎,贏得多個獎項,成功
踏出創業的第一步。
除了資金外,相關技術對於Jack創辦的廚餘回收社會
企業亦不可或缺。勝出香港社會企業挑戰賽後,Jack
和拍檔前往台灣取經。他們曾到中興大學請教該校教
授,學習處理廚餘的技術,將有機廢棄物轉化為肥
料。此外,商業運作亦是創業的重要關鍵。為了瞭解
由廚餘轉化的肥料在香港的市場潛力,Jack亦親身到
各有機農場與具潛力的銷售對象交流。
